The Tumblenook locker API governs the full laundry-locker access flow: a customer requests a drop-off, the service reserves a compartment, and a one-time unlock code is issued on arrival. Release builds must exercise this sequence end-to-end against the staging fleet before sign-off. Staging requests authenticate through the internal gateway, and the credential for that gateway appears below.

gateway credential: vxb4-QTMv

Subject: Kivvet SDK cut-over done

Hey future folks — we finished the cut-over from the old Brambleworks Java SDK to the new Kotlin one on Friday. Feature parity is confirmed: retries, pagination, and offline caching all match. The only gap is the legacy telemetry hook, which we dropped on purpose. Nothing else should surprise you. For reference, the service runs with the following configuration values.

service settings:
[casax]
port = 6379
team = rusir
host = casax.zemvarhq.corp
region = outer-4
access_code = ac_9808ce
timeout_ms = 1500

## Local setup

Clone the Fernwheel component library and install with `pnpm i`. Versioning follows strict semver: patch releases auto-publish nightly, minors require a changelog entry, majors need sign-off from the platform chapter. Never pin to `latest` in consumer apps; use the lockfile committed in each release branch. To run the demo catalog locally you also need the tokens database seeded — run `pnpm seed` first. The seeder expects a reachable Postgres instance and will read the connection string provided below.

primary connection of yagep-kahip = redis://giliel_svc:zYiKsLL2PLpfPL@db-348f.xolmarsys.corp:5432/fenwyn

Q2 Planning Note — Annual Billing

Board folks, quick one: we're pulling the trigger on annual billing for Lumebright's core plans. Monthly stays as an option, but the default flips at signup with a 10% prepay sweetener. Modelling says cash position improves roughly two months of runway, and churn mechanics get simpler. Support's biggest worry is refund requests mid-term; we've drafted a pro-rata policy to cover that. Rollout starts with the Averline cohort in May, rest by August. The reasoning we'd rather keep in this room is below.

board note of fahif-yahog: Gross margin on Wenath came in at 10 percent against a plan of 5 percent. Only 3 of the 100 pilot accounts renewed Wenath, so a churn review is set for July 15.